The proliferation of smartphone technology means that a woman's public behavior can be captured, edited, and uploaded without consent. This has created a culture of "digital honor," where social media users often act as moral police. Viral videos of women dancing or interacting in public often spark intense online abuse, demonstrating a societal tendency to prioritize rigid patriarchal norms over individual privacy.
